PGA Tour Champions is a place for senior golfers, 50 and over, to continue their prolific careers and for some lesser-known names to enjoy the taste of competition and, in some cases, winning. However, there is one player with the most PGA Tour Champions wins that stands out well ahead of the others who have joined and played on the erstwhile senior tour since 1980.

Hale Irwin has, far and away, the most PGA Tour Champions wins, taking 45 titles since joining the tour in 1995. He still plays on the senior circuit, but he hasn't won since 2007. He's now 71 years old. In his career, Irwin won seven senior majors, two behind Bernhard Langer's mark.

Bernhard Langer shared the mark with Nicklaus for the most senior major wins with eight, until he won the 2017 Senior PGA Championship to bring his tally to nine. The German and former world No. 1 also has the second-most PGA Tour Champions wins, owning 32 titles since joining the senior tour in 2007. Now 60, Langer is still playing dominating golf.

Lee Trevino has the third most PGA Tour Champions wins at 29, while Dr. Gil Morgan has the fourth most with 25.

Of players who joined PGA Tour Champions since 2000, Jay Haas is next best after Langer with 18 wins.
